the wild rose is on Cty W between Wabeno and Crandon
From Wabeno go West on Hwy 52 to W and it is about 5 Miles, from Crandon 32 south to W and it is 5 to 7 miles. Good place to go eat after finding the end of the earth cache it is on Roberts Lake
Another good place to eat in Lakewood is Mulligans Sports Bar
the wings are great 10 flavors to choose from and any other thing on the menu is good too, they make their own pizzas
